Eligibility Requirements

To join the Canadian Army, you must meet certain eligibility requirements. These include:

1. Canadian citizenship or permanent resident status
2. Minimum age of 17 years (18 years for certain trades)
3. Good physical and mental health
4. Valid driver’s license (for some trades)
5. Educational qualifications (varies by trade)

Recruitment Process

The recruitment process for the Canadian Army is thorough and competitive.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to proceed:

1. Research: Visit the Canadian Armed Forces website to gather information about the different trades, roles, and requirements.
2. Contact: Reach out to a local military recruitment center or attend a recruitment event to discuss your options with a recruiter.
3. Initial Assessment: Complete an initial assessment to determine your suitability for military service. This may include a physical fitness test, a medical examination, and an aptitude test.
4. Trades and Training: If you pass the initial assessment, you’ll be assigned a trade and undergo basic military training at the Canadian Forces Base (CFB) Gagetown in New Brunswick.
5. Advanced Training: After completing basic training, you’ll receive specialized training for your chosen trade.
6. Commissioning: If you wish to pursue a leadership role, you can apply for officer training through the Royal Military College of Canada or the Canadian Forces College.
